Multi-body dynamics in full-vehicle handling analysisHegazy, S., Rahnejat, H., Hussain, Khalid January 1999 (has links)
This paper presents a multidegrees-of-freedom non-linear multibody dynamic model of a
vehicle, comprising front and rear suspensions, steering system, road wheels, tyres and vehicle inertia. The
model incorporates all sources of compliance, stiffness and damping, all with non-linear characteristics.
The vehicle model is created in ADAMS (automatic dynamic analysis of mechanical systems) formulation.
The model is used for the purpose of vehicle handling analysis. Simulation runs, in-line with vehicle
manoeuvres specified under ISO and British Standards, have been undertaken and reported in the paper.

Transient vehicle handling analysis with aerodynamic interactionsHussain, Khalid, Rahnejat, H., Hegazy, S. January 2007 (has links)
Yes / This article presents transient handling analysis with a full-vehicle non-linear
multi-body dynamic model, having 102 degrees of freedom. A transient cornering manoeuvre,
with a constant steer angle and velocity has been undertaken. The effects of aerodynamic lift
and drag forces have been included in the simulation tests. The vehicle handling characteristics
with and without aerodynamic forces have been compared and various observations made. The
aerodynamic forces have been predicted by a k¿1 model solution of the Navier¿Stokes equations
for turbulent flow. The numerical predictions for the evaluation of aerodynamic lift coefficient
agrees well with the scaled-down air tunnel experimental work, using hot-wire anemometry
